Posts: 29 Tumbler Ridge, BC Canada | I decided to do some modifications to my kickstand after it started to bend. I talked to my dealer about it and he put in a request to have it replaced under warranty. Polaris never replied - big surprise.
I wrote Polaris about it and they told me my 5-year warranty does not cover as the kickstand is only covered under the first year - Another big surprise!
So then I straightened it in a press and split some heavy wall 1? square tubing, fit it around the kickstand, clamped it tight and welded the tubing back together.
While I was at it I replaced the rubber pad on the bottom that wears out way too quickly with an old piece of a car tire and stainless rivets.
